The Outpatient Program Therapist provides clinical social services and therapeutic treatment skills to enable patients to achieve their optimal level of emotional and behavioral health.
ResponsibilitiesOutpatient Program Therapist
PRN/Per Diem
The Outpatient Program Therapist is responsible for psychosocial assessments, group and family therapy, participation in treatment team planning, processing commitments, discharge planning/ case management services, making referrals, crisis intervention and acting as a liaison with referral sources and other departments within the hospital.

- A master’s degree in counseling, social work, psychology or a closely related behavioral health field and two years of professional counseling experience in a substance abuse or mental health treatment program OR any equivalent combination of education and experience.
- A minimum of 2 years of full-time behavioral health experience in a psychiatric health care facility, with direct experience in group therapies, crisis intervention, and treatment skills; must have strong clinical assessment skills. A combination of education, licensure and experience and/ or student internship hours may be considered.
- Licensure issued by the Arizona Board of Behavioral Health Examiners to engage in the practice of behavioral health in Arizona. LAC, LPC, LMSW or LCSW Required.
- Must have or be able to obtain a Level 1 Fingerprint Clearance Card.
